The Terminal San Giorgio is located at the “Ponte Libia” in the western part of the port of Genoa and comprises a total area of 79,550m2 with a quay length of 550m.
Rickmers-Linie vessels are regular callers at the terminal, with sailings of the company’s dedicated service to the Middle East and Indian Subcontinent every third week and fortnightly departures to South East Asia and the Far East within the “Round-The-World Pearl String Service”.
“We are pleased that the Rickmers Group has joined the other partners of Terminal San Giorgio – Genoa”, said P G Raimondi, Chairman of TSG. “Rickmers-Linie has been our most important supporter since the beginning of our operations. We are sure we will be able to meet Rickmers’ requirements as the line expands its worldwide services calling at the port of Genoa.”
Jan B Steffens, President & CEO of Rickmers-Linie, added: “We are very satisfied with this intensified cooperation in Genoa. Together with our partners, we are now able to develop and offer value added services to our customers at TSG.
“We are now holding shares in all three of the terminals in Europe we serve on a regular basis. We have thus secured for ourselves, and even more importantly for our customers, access to handling capacity in these ports for the cargoes carried on our vessels.”
With more than 170 years to its name, Rickmers-Linie, based in Hamburg, Germany is one of the world’s leading specialists in the global transportation of breakbulk, heavylift and project cargo by sea. The company belongs to Rickmers Group, which offers diversified activities in the fields of liner shipping, shipowning and shipmanagement, investments and real estate as well as maritime related services.
